This parameter determines the note value (A0 to C8) that pressing (ENTER-YES) on this screen (or
on the Edit Context page) will play. In other words, pressing (ENTER-YES] on either the Edit
Context page, or on this screen will be the equivalent of playing a note on the keyboard, at a
velocity of 127. This provides a way to manually trigger notes from the front panel of the ASR-10
without playing a key (or having a keyboard connected).
Using the ENTER PLAYS KEY Parameter
The ENTER PLAYS KEY parameter, found on the Edit/System*MIDI page, allows you to play
any key between A0 to C8 without having to play a note on the keyboard. By using the Data
Entry Slider or the
a
and
m
buttons, you can select each key and play it by pressing the
(ENTER-YES) button.
Let’s experiment with this feature by using the (ENTER-YES) button to play some of the keys
assigned in the STEREO DRUMS instrument (from disk #AD-O07 that came with your ASR-10).
